Omeprazole Capsules IP 20 mg is a proton pump inhibitor (PPI) that works by reducing stomach acid production, making it effective for treating acidity, GERD (gastroesophageal reflux disease), peptic ulcers, and Zollinger-Ellison syndrome. It helps relieve symptoms like heartburn, acid reflux, and indigestion, and also promotes healing of the stomach lining in conditions like gastritis and ulcers. While Omeprazole is generally safe, long-term use may cause side effects such as headaches, constipation, B12 and calcium deficiencies, or an increased risk of infections due to reduced stomach acid. It is usually recommended once daily before breakfast, but prolonged use should be under a doctor’s supervision to prevent complications. For those seeking natural alternatives, Ayurveda suggests remedies that help balance stomach acid and improve digestion. Ajwain (carom seeds) and fennel seeds aid in digestion and prevent gas buildup, while Triphala supports gut health and relieves acidity. Other effective remedies include Amla (Indian gooseberry) for cooling the stomach, licorice (Yashtimadhu) for ulcer healing, and buttermilk with rock salt for soothing acidity. Lifestyle changes like eating smaller meals, avoiding spicy foods, and practicing yoga can also help manage acidity naturally.
